This particular dream has been going on now for probably about a year or more but, not very offten through out the year(s); I say years because it seems like it's been more than a year, every time I have it, I'm getting more and more confused in the dream.

Here's the dream..

I get a call from my XO (Executive Officer) in the military service I was in, covo goes something like this..

XO: "Staff Sargent (last name) why are you here?"

ME: " Hello, who is this ??!

XO: "Your commanding officer, from your unit~!"

ME:" ahhh.. sir.. I'm not in the military any more .., I was honorably discharged like 30 years ago~!"

XO: "get in here or you'll be AWOL"

He hangs up, I show up, get all my uniforms, all the time I'm completely confused, trying to remember what I need to do, I'm so far behind in my duties, I can't travel with the company to the training site..

anyone else have this type of dream.. meaning being in a former occupation (military/gov) and having it reoccurring .. ?

I'm no expert, but from what I've learned...

When ever you have a dream, first discern if it's a vivid (or a premonition, which latered will be accounted as deja vu), which is usually not the case with reoccurring dreams or if it's a symbolic dream. If it's a symbolic dream you must start by defining the symbols.

What did you XO represent to you, was he a mentor, was he a bastard, was he an acquaintance?

Was your rank and promotions important to you during your service? If so, are they still important now.

Is there anything else you've stopped doing recently, maybe a bad habit or stopped associating with certain people?

Are there any forces trying to drag you back to do something? Did you want to serve or was it forced by draft?

Is there something in your life you've neglected recently or have forgotten about or disconnected from? Like family or friends?
